Veryyyy comfy chair but needs a shorter gas cylinder
*I’m 5’8 155lb*PROS: This is a very comfy chair with excellent lumbar support. It was fairly easy to assemble and feels very sturdy. No squeak's when leaning back or moving around in the chair. The chair wheels roll fine and are quiet on my hardwood floors but still might swap them. The adjustments for armrest, headrest, and backrest are solid and stay put. My sister has a Herman Miller aeron and I swear this is better if not more comfy.CONS-ish: The footrest has a hard edge that might make it uncomfortable behind your shin when fully extending your legs but I usually prop my feet on it instead of extending them so it’s fine.The ONLY downside has to be chair height. When fully lowered, my feet are flat on the floor but I wish it could go lower cause the padding on the front edge of the seat digs into my lower thigh. Also when I lean back and begin to recline w/o the footrest, my feet are about 1-2 inches off the ground and I can only fully recline when pushing on my tip toes. A shorter gas cylinder might do the trick or maybe shorter wheels but they’re already ~2 inch wheels and I’m not sure what replacement cylinder would fit and not void the warranty. *Will update to 5⭐️ if I find a replacement cylinderOverall, this chair is a keeper and I’m glad I bought it 👍🏽👍🏽

Soooo close.
This is almost the perfect chair. I'm 6'5/260 and this chair is perfect for my size. Build quality is outstanding. Mesh is softer and not the scratchy kind that pulls your shirt up. Assembly is easy - 6 arm screws, 3 back screws, 2 headrest screws, took less than 15 minutes. There is one arm screw directly beneath the movement arm, but they include a separate allen key to reach it. Arms have good movement that stay in place, and the up/down movable back is a great feature I think we'll start to see a lot more of in the future. The footrest is probably okay for shorter people, but it was pretty useless for me. My calves rested on the end of it making it uncomfortable, but honestly I wouldn't use it anyway.The only reason for 3 stars and why I'm returning - The photo shows "100-130 degree Recline and Lock" and that's literally what it is. You get one lock at 100 degrees and one lock at 130 degrees. Nothing in-between. There is a tension screw, but it made very little difference, not like the other chairs with the large knob.With little tension, it's either fully upright or fully laid back so it feels like I'm doing a constant sit-up. One more lock setting somewhere in-between or a stronger tension spring and this would be one of the best values I've ever found. This chair is still better than any of the $500+ chairs I tried out in person at office depot, just not quite working out for me though.
